Melamine-15N3
- CAS No.: 287476-11-3
- Formula:C3H6N315N3
- Molecular Weight:129.10
IUPAC Name: 1,3,5-triazine-2,4,6-triamine-15N3
InChIKey: JDSHMPZPIAZGSV-VMGGCIAMSA-N
SMILES: [15NH2]C1=NC([15NH2])=NC([15NH2])=N1
Biological Activity: Melamine-15N3 is a 15N-labeled Melamine. Melamine is a metabolite?of?cyromazine. Melamine is a intermediate for the synthesis of melamine resin and plastic materials[1].
